Piscataway Man Pleads Guilty to Cocaine Distribution in Lakewood and Toms River
Cocaine was distributed in both Lakewood and Toms River townships as part of a drug investigation that ultimately led to a guilty plea in Ocean County Superior Court. Ocean County Prosecutor Bradley D. Billhimer announced that on February 2, 2026, Shaun Anderson, 47, of Piscataway, pled guilty to Distribution of Over One-Half Ounce of Cocaine […]
